The Pima County Medical Examiner's Office is asking people to take DNA tests, in the hopes of identifying a teenager killed 20 years ago.

Sep 30, 2024
TUCSON, Ariz. — The Pima County Medical Examiner's Office is putting out a call for help to hopefully solve a cold case.

20 years ago, in September of 2004, a teenager was shot and killed near the border. Now, genealogists think he may have family in the Tucson area, but they say we might never figure out his name unless more relatives come forward.

"He was in an area that, at the time was more restricted to drug smuggling than people smuggling, just inside the border, not too far from Sasabe, Mexico," said Dr. Bruce Anderson, a forensic anthropologist at the medical examiner's office.
